For now, let’s zero in on The Ramsden and take a look at selling prices in March and April 2016.

Only three condo suites were sold during this time period.

A one bedroom plus den suite on a very low floor was sold for $490,000. This sale came with a storage locker but no parking spot and no balcony. The suite faced west and was more than 1000 square feet.

A couple of floors higher, another one bedroom plus den suite was sold, but this suite came with two full bathrooms. The suite faced east and the selling price at 980 Yonge for this unit was $535,000. A storage locker and parking spot were both included.

And about midway up the 908 Yonge Street Ramsden condo building, a 2 bedroom, 2 bathroom suite was sold for $612,000. The suite was more than 1000 square feet and included a storage locker and an underground parking space. There was a balcony and the suite faced southwest.
